## Transcoding Farm — On-Call Notes

The Miravue transcoding farm runs worker pools in three zones, coordinated by the `herdmaster` scheduler. Each job's state transitions are written synchronously, so a stalled job almost always means a stuck worker lease rather than lost data. Before force-releasing any lease, verify its heartbeat timestamp in the jobs table. To inspect job state directly, connect to the scheduler database with the following string.

primary connection of yagep-kahip = redis://giliel_svc:zYiKsLL2PLpfPL@db-348f.xolmarsys.corp:5432/fenwyn

TICKET: Missed pick-up — Brixel prototype boards for the Oakhollow test lab. Courier didn't make the Friday window, so the crate is still sitting in our receiving cage. Rebooked for Monday morning; receiving site, please hold a bench slot. Crate stays sealed until the lab signs. Give the courier this confidential hand-over instruction on arrival.

handover note for yagef-bagep: the drudor pelius courier leaves the kasdor zorvan norir ledger at gate 8016 under passcode 755406

Capacity-planning note: connection pooling for the Ashgrove order database.

Ahead of the next release, note that each application replica holds a fixed-size connection pool, and the database enforces a hard cap across all replicas. Adding replicas without adjusting pool size will exhaust the cap and cause connect timeouts at startup — this bit us during the Wrenfield rollout. Idle connections are reaped on a timer, and checkout waits are bounded, so saturation shows up as latency before errors. Plan replica counts against the constants below.

tuning constants:
QUOTAS = {
    "druwyn": 5,
    "holix": 5,
    "zorath": 5,
    "holwyn": 10,
}

## Runbook: Nightly Search Reindex (Corvid Search)

The reindex job runs every night after the content freeze window closes. If a customer reports stale results the next morning, first confirm the job completed rather than restarting it blindly, since a second concurrent run can corrupt the alias swap. Check the scheduler dashboard, then compare the live settings against the expected values shown below.

service settings:
PRAWYN_PIN=9848
PRAWYN_METRICS_HOST=metrics.prawyn.lumicworks.corp
PRAWYN_LOG_LEVEL=warn
PRAWYN_TENANT=pelius